Description:

DBM- dead burnt magnesia is produced using selected natural magnesite that is purified and is calcined in a shaft kiln.The final product is used for electric furnace floors and furnace liner tamping.
high temperature performance and high-density, strong anti-permeability ability and easy to rapid sintering, very thin sintered layer,good thermal shock stability, strong slag-resistance, long service life and so on.

Q:What requirements should refractory materials meet?
The operating temperature of forging furnace is above 1000, which can ensure the normal operation of the furnace, prolong the life of the furnace and save energy. General requirements for refractories are as follows. 1 They should deform at a sufficient temperature without melting. 2, They should have necessary structural strength without softening and deforming. The volume should be stable at high temperature without expansion, contraction or cracking. 4, They can resist erosion of molten metal, slag, gas and other chemicals.

Q:What are the requirements of the performances of brasque refractory?
Physical properties of refractory include structural properties, thermal properties, mechanical properties, usability and operation property. The selection of the brasque refractory must have the following characteristics: 1. properties of not distortion and not melting at sufficient temperatures 2. have the necessary structural strength at high temperatures and does not soften and deform 3. must keep stable volume at high temperatures and will notcrack caused by expansion and contraction 4. will not rapture and flake when temperature is drasticly changed or heated unevenly 5. resistant to chemical erosion of metallic solution, slag and furnace gas, etc.

Q:Why should graphitic refractory materials be used now that graphite can burn?
C is inactive in nature. Carbon will not burn unless the temperature is about 2000℃, so it can't be lit generally. Coal can be lit because it contains other combustible substance which ignite carbon indirectly. While graphite, carbon black, is more pure and dense than coal., so it is hard to oxidize.Their molecular structures are also different, just like diamond is harder than graphite.
Q:Is the ball mill used in production of refractories?
Refractory is a kind of non-metallic material that is of resistance to thermal shock and chemical erosion, low thermal conductivity and low expansion coefficient. The refractoriness of the refractory is not less than 1580℃. The usage of the refractory is broad. Refractory materials include refractory bricks and powders. Abandoned refractory bricks can be recreated as new bricks after they are crushed by a crusher and grinded by a ball mill. The ball mill and crusher are needed to grind and crush the material in the production of the refractory.
